/* Search results CSS File */

/* Page elements */
#middleContent{width:540px;}
#rightContent{width:202px;}

/* Toolbar elements */
#searchmenu{width:202px; font-size:100%;  text-align:left; font-weight:bold;}
	*html #searchmenu{margin-left:5px;}
#searchmenuTop{background:url(/images_new/menu/menu_bckgrd_top.jpg) no-repeat; height:34px; padding:15px 0 0 10px;}
#searchmenuMiddle{background:url(/images_new/menu/menu_bckgrd_middle.gif) repeat-y; padding-left:10px; padding-right:10px; margin-top:-15px;}
#searchmenuMiddle p{margin:3px 0 3px 0;}
#searchmenuIEfix{margin-top:0;}
.searchmenuLink a:link, .searchmenuLink a:active, .searchmenuLink a:visited{
	display:block;
	line-height:22px;
	text-decoration:none;
	border-top:1px dotted #C0C0C0;
	background:url(/images_new/menu/menu_arrow.gif) no-repeat left;
	padding-left:20px;
	color:#036;
}
.searchmenuLink a:hover{text-decoration:none; color:#FFFFFF; background:none; background-color:#777777;}
.searchmenuHeader{font-weight:bold; margin:15px 0 5px 0;}
#searchmenuBottom{background:url(/images_new/menu/menu_bckgrd_bottom.gif) no-repeat; height:8px;}
#emailResults, #refinePrice, #refinePlate {border-top:1px dotted #C0C0C0; padding:8px 5px; }
#regFinder, #searchpageMagazine{margin-top:5px; text-align:center;}


/* Top elements */
#chooseRT{/*float:right; margin:-5px 10px 0 0; */}
#searchAgain{/* float:right;  margin:-20px 3px 0 0; */ margin:10px 0;}
#pageControl{margin-bottom:5px; float:left;}
#pageControl a:link, #pageControl a:active, #pageControl a:visited{text-decoration:none; color:#888; background-color:#DDD; font-weight:bold; padding:1px 2px 1px 2px;}
#pageControl span a:link, #pageControl span a:active, #pageControl span a:visited{text-decoration:none; color:#888; background-color:#FFF; font-weight:normal;}
#pageControl span a:hover{text-decoration:underline;}
#pageControl a:hover{color:#FFF; background-color:#888;}


/* Results table */
#resultsInc{font-weight:bold;}
.resultsBlock ul{border-top:1px dotted #C0C0C0; margin:0px; list-style: none; padding-top:3px; height:24px; /*width:560px;  margin-left:-30px;*/}
.resultsBlock li{display:block; float:left;}
.regPlate{
	margin-left:30px; 
	text-align:center; 
	width:73px; 
	height:19px; 
	background:url(/images_new/searchresults/plate_white_bck.jpg) no-repeat;
	padding-top:2px;
}
.regPlateYellow{
	background:url(/images_new/searchresults/plate_yellow_bck.jpg) no-repeat;
	margin-left:30px; 
	text-align:center; 
	width:73px; 
	height:19px;
	padding-top:2px;
}
.words{width:80px; text-align:left;}
.oldprice{text-align:right; width:50px; margin-left:5px;}
.price{text-align:right; width:60px; margin-left:3px;}
.buyButton{width:73px; margin-left:3px;}
.enquireButton{width:76px; margin-left:3px;}
.offerButton{width:76px; margin-left:3px;}
.payplan{width:76px; margin-left:3px;}
.searchSpacer{width:76px; margin-left:3px;}
.favourite{}
.regPlate a:link, .regPlate a:active, .regPlate a:visited{text-decoration:none; color:#000;}
.regPlateYellow a:link, .regPlateYellow a:active, .regPlateYellow a:visited{text-decoration:none; color:#000;}
.categoryBar{background-color:#FFE57F; height:20px; padding-top:5px; padding-left:10px; /*clear:both; width:520px;*/}
.categoryBar a:link, .categoryBar a:active, .categoryBar a:visited{text-decoration:none; color:#036;}
.categoryBar a:hover{text-decoration:underline;}
.easyview{font-family:Arial, Helvetica, sans-serif; font-size:150%; font-style:italic;}
.searchresultsSearchBox{text-align:center; color:#999; width:100px;}
.newSearchBox{font-weight:bold; text-transform:uppercase; color:#333; width:100px; text-align:center; letter-spacing:0.1em;}
.gnpfsHolder{width:24px; position:relative; margin-left:-24px;}
.gnpfsLink{position:absolute; left:15px;}
